Choosing the Right Replacement Battery

Choosing the right replacement battery is essential for ensuring the key fob functions properly. It’s important to check the owner’s manual for the specific battery type needed. Many Cadillac key fobs use CR2032 batteries, but not all do. Identifying the correct size and type prevents further issues down the line. By selecting the right battery, one can ensure the key fob operates smoothly and reliably.

Gathering Necessary Tools

Gathering necessary tools is essential for anyone looking to change their Cadillac key fob battery efficiently. It’s important to have a small flathead screwdriver on hand to help pry open the key fob. A replacement battery, typically a CR2032, should also be ready for the swap. Additionally, having a pair of tweezers can assist in handling the small components inside the fob. Lastly, a clean, flat surface ensures the process goes smoothly without losing any tiny parts.

Opening the Key Fob

Opening the key fob is often easier than it seems, and she’s ready to get started. First, she’ll locate the small notch on the side of the fob. With a gentle pry using a flat tool, it’ll pop open without much effort. Once the fob’s case is split, she’ll reveal the battery compartment inside. Finally, she’ll carefully remove the old battery, preparing for the next step.

Removing the Old Battery

They’ve carefully removed the old battery from the key fob, ensuring not to damage any components. They’ve noticed the battery’s orientation, making it easier to insert the new one later. They’ve set the old battery aside, taking care to dispose of it properly. They’ve inspected the battery compartment for any debris or corrosion that could affect the new battery’s performance. They’ve confirmed that everything looks clean and ready for the replacement.

Installing the New Battery

Installing the new battery requires aligning it properly within the key fob’s compartment. Once it’s positioned correctly, he or she should gently press down until it clicks into place. After that, he or she can reassemble the key fob by snapping the cover back on. It’s important to ensure that everything fits snugly to prevent any issues later on. Finally, testing the key fob will confirm that the new battery is functioning as expected.

Reassembling the Key Fob

Reassembling the key fob is straightforward once all components are properly aligned. They need to ensure that the battery sits snugly in its compartment. After that, the two halves of the fob can be pressed together until they click. It’s important to check for any gaps to confirm everything’s secure. Finally, testing the key fob ensures it’s functioning correctly before use.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should i replace my cadillac key fob battery?

When it comes to replacing a Cadillac key fob battery, it’s generally recommended to do so every two to three years. However, the specific timing can vary based on usage and environmental factors. If someone’s frequently using their key fob or living in extreme temperatures, they might find that their battery drains faster. It’s also worth noting that many signs indicate a weakening battery, like decreased range or unresponsive buttons. Keeping an eye on these symptoms can help ensure that the fob remains functional. Overall, regular checks and timely replacements can save a lot of frustration down the line.

What should i do if my key fob still doesn’t work after replacing the battery?

If someone finds that their key fob still isn’t working after replacing the battery, there are a few things they can check. First, they should ensure the new battery was installed correctly, as a misalignment can prevent it from functioning. If that’s not the issue, it might be worth inspecting the fob for any signs of damage or wear, which could affect its operation. They could also try reprogramming the key fob, as sometimes a reset is necessary after a battery change. If it still doesn’t respond, consulting the vehicle’s manual for specific troubleshooting steps is advisable. Lastly, visiting a dealership or a professional locksmith may be necessary, especially if there’s a deeper issue at play.
